Infants who are born large for gestational age (LGA), especially full-term or post-term infants, are at risk for perinatal morbidity and potentially long-term metabolic complications. The pathogenesis, epidemiology, risk factors, complications, and management of infants born LGA will be reviewed here. WebLGA refers to neonatal birth weight larger than the 90th percentile for a given gestational age. In contrast to LGA, fetal macrosomia is defined as an absolute birth weight above a specified threshold regardless of gestational age. Varying thresholds have been used, including 4000 g and 4500 g, and both thresholds have been associated with ...

WebGiving birth to an LGA baby can be hard on the baby and the mother. In a vaginal delivery, the large baby has to squeeze through the narrow birth canal. The squeezing can injure the baby's shoulders or arms. The mother may have more difficult and painful labour. The doctor may recommend that the baby be born by caesarean section.

While there are many published definitions, … WebLarge for gestational age (LGA) is used to describe newborn babies who weigh more than usual for the number of weeks of pregnancy. Babies may be called large for gestational age if they weigh more than 9 in 10 babies (90th percentile) of the same gestational age. This is based on U.S. statistics from 1991.
